Nomyth: That's because most African players started out playing on the streets (what we call "set" in Nigeria) as against being educated in academies.
Playing "sets" means there is no way for the player to hone his skills in set pieces as they are non existent. The pitch is even too small to allow for corner kicks to begin with.
It is for this reason our goalkeepers are poor at corner kicks ( and crosses generally). A friend told me that Victor Osimhen had to learn offside because in set football there is no offside. Chukwueze lack of end product. It goes on snd on. We native Africans learn football in a very raw way. |

TheSuperNerd: He only gets dropped if he fumbles "repeatedly". That's the key word.
Okoye is doing well at Udinese and we are happy but Nwabali remains #1 especially after his Afcon performance and continued good form in the SA PSL.
Nwabali has established great synergy with the Backline and is more adaptable and this is something Okoye hasn't achieved just yet despite being #1 at Afcon 2021.
Also, while both GKs are mentally strong, Nwabali edges mentally for now. He has the confidence and trust of his NT defenders.
Nwabali's Mentality profile and confidence spills over into Penalties as well. He has a way of getting into the opponents' heads in spotkick situations. Seen him do it in the SA PSL and we saw it at the Afcon too. Okoye can't top that for the time being.
